From bbb0cfbf3aca824984ba00c124421a29dadcfdfc Mon Sep 17 00:00:00 2001 From: MrFry Date: Wed, 1 Apr 2020 13:30:30 +0200 Subject: [PATCH] Info getting only every x seconds fix if server is not avaible, removed unnecesarry logging --- stable.user.js | 9 ++++----- 1 file changed, 4 insertions(+), 5 deletions(-) diff --git a/stable.user.js b/stable.user.js index 697e5ec..e9a2d36 100755 --- a/stable.user.js +++ b/stable.user.js @@ -21,7 +21,7 @@ // ==UserScript== // @name Moodle/Elearning/KMOOC test help -// @version 2.0.0.5 +// @version 2.0.0.6 // @description Online Moodle/Elearning/KMOOC test help // @author MrFry // @match https://elearning.uni-obuda.hu/main/* @@ -60,8 +60,9 @@ var addEventListener // add event listener function const serverAdress = 'https://qmining.frylabs.net/' - const apiAdress = 'https://api.frylabs.net/' // const serverAdress = 'http://localhost:8080/' + const apiAdress = 'https://api.frylabs.net/' + // const apiAdress = 'http://localhost:8080/' const ircAddress = 'https://kiwiirc.com/nextclient/irc.sub.fm/#qmining' // forcing pages for testing. unless you test, do not set these to true! @@ -1621,14 +1622,13 @@ } if (now > lastCheck + (infoExpireTime * 1000)) { - console.log('GETTING DATA FROM SREVER') - setVal('lastInfoCheckTime', now) return new Promise((resolve, reject) => { xmlhttpRequest({ method: 'GET', url: apiAdress + 'infos?version=true&motd=true&subjinfo=true&cversion=' + info().script.version, onload: function (response) { try { + setVal('lastInfoCheckTime', now) const res = JSON.parse(response.responseText) setVal('lastInfo', response.responseText) resolve(res) @@ -1645,7 +1645,6 @@ }) }) } else { - console.log('USING OLD') return new Promise((resolve, reject) => { try { resolve(JSON.parse(getVal('lastInfo')))